#09424e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#09424e is composed of 3.5% red, 25.9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 190.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 17.1%. #09424e color hex could be obtained by blending #12849c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#09424e color description : Very dark cyan.

#09424e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#09424e has RGB values of R:9, G:66,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 606798.

Shades and Tints of #09424e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010608 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#09424e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2c2d is the less saturated color, while #024655 is the most saturated one.
